New regulations from Queensland Health require all cosmetic injectable clinics to have a Medical Director overseeing prescribing and dispensing of medications.
To comply with these changes, from 1st September a $25 prescribing/dispensing fee will apply to every cosmetic treatment that requires prescription medication. This fee is added to your deposit and will be added to your treatment total at checkout.
The fee will be added onto every cosmetic treatment- with the exception of review appointments. Skin treatments not requiring prescriptions remain exempt.
